Insect Control Service in Katy, TX
Insect control services for homeowners involve identifying and managing common household pests such as ants, cockroaches, spiders, and silverfish. These services typically include inspections to locate pest activity, targeted treatments to eliminate existing insects, and preventative measures to reduce the likelihood of future infestations. Projects may range from addressing a sudden pest problem to ongoing maintenance plans designed to keep a property pest-free throughout the year.
Homeowners interested in insect control often want to understand the scope of treatments, the types of pests covered, and any preparations needed before service. It’s also helpful to know about the frequency of treatments and whether the service includes follow-up visits if pests return. Clear communication about the methods used and the areas treated can assist property owners in making informed decisions to protect their homes from unwanted insects.

Common Insect Control Service Jobs
Insect Extermination - targeted treatments to eliminate common pests like ants, roaches, and silverfish.
Infestation Prevention - inspection and sealing of entry points to reduce future insect problems.
Bed Bug Control - specialized methods to safely remove bed bugs from residential properties.
Cricket and Mole Cricket Control - solutions to manage nuisance insects around lawns and gardens.
Spider and Pest Barrier Services - installation of barriers to help keep spiders and other insects outside.
Seasonal Pest Management - customized plans to address insect activity throughout the year.
Insect Control Service Questions
What types of insects can be controlled? Insect control services target common pests such as ants, cockroaches, spiders, termites, and mosquitoes to help protect properties.
How does insect control work? Treatments typically involve applying targeted solutions to areas where insects are active or likely to hide, reducing infestations and preventing future issues.
Are treatments safe for pets and children? Yes, insect control methods are designed to be safe for households when applied properly, with precautions to minimize exposure.
What property areas are treated? Treatments usually focus on entry points, cracks, crevices, and outdoor spaces like yards and gardens to effectively manage pests.
